Description:
I am getting the impression that the pre-release binaries from
https://dev-builds.libreoffice.org/pre-releases/ do not contain neither the kf6
nor the gtk4 VCL plugins. This makes it a bit difficult to use the pre-release
binaries to check whether there is progress with these VCLs.

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Download and install pre-release binaries (either as rpms or debs), e.g. for
25.2
2. SAL_USE_VCLPLUGIN=kf6 libreoffice25.2


Actual Results:
See that the application is starting with the kf5 or gtk3 VCL.

Expected Results:
Should be possible to start the application on the kf6 or gtk4 VCL plugins


Reproducible: Always


User Profile Reset: No

Additional Info:
Version: 25.2.1.2 (X86_64) / LibreOffice Community
Build ID: d3abf4aee5fd705e4a92bba33a32f40bc4e56f49
CPU threads: 16; OS: Linux 6.12; UI render: default; VCL: kf5 (cairo+wayland)
Locale: it-IT (en_US.UTF-8); UI: en-US
Calc: threaded


Additional info: if I look into the archive downloaded from the pre-release
server, I find "integration" packages (rpms or debs) for gnome and kde that
contain the VCL code, however there is no libvclplug_kf6lo.so,
libvclplug_qt6lo.so
 or libvclplug_gtk4lo
